About The Position

This is advanced and technical work in the procurement of diversified and complex commodities/services required to support the Department of Health headquarters administration and program operations. Serves as administrative lead on competitive solicitations, administrative review with contract managers, contract administration, and general counsel’s office, ensuring all stages of the process are timely and in accordance with statute, rule, and procedure; Evaluates and processes assigned purchase requests for commodities and contractual services for the department using appropriate purchasing methods in accordance with laws, rules, policies, and procedures.

Responsibilities

  • Serves as administrative lead on competitive solicitations, administrative review with contract managers, contract administration, and general counsel’s office, ensuring all stages of the process are timely and in accordance with statute, rule, and procedure
  • Evaluates and processes assigned purchase requests for commodities and contractual services for the department using appropriate purchasing methods in accordance with laws, rules, policies, and procedures.
  • Reviews and approves requisitions in MyFloridaMarketPlace (MFMP) for commodities and contractual services using appropriate purchasing method in accordance with laws, rules, policies, and procedures.
  • Responsible for processing all Sponsorship Requests, Agency Alternate Contract Source (ACS) and Requests and Vendor Transaction Fee Disputes in accordance with laws, rules, policies, and procedures.  Serves as the Vendor Transaction Fee Dispute Liaison for the Department.  Serves as the backup for processing formal Statements of Work.
  • Attends meetings, workshops, and conferences keeping current with changes or additions to purchasing rules, laws, and procedures. Assists with updating and revising department’s Purchasing Policies and Procedures Manual, Desk Reference, and various purchasing guides. Directs and conducts workshops.
  • Works closely with program offices and CHDs to ensure purchasing requirements are met in a timely and economical manner.
  • Performs other related duties, as required.
